The learning of "Cuatro" in Venezuela, a case of informal and nonformal education throughout six decades of publications

Abstract

This work deals with the features and importance of the methods and manuals
that have the purpose of facilitating the learning of the cuatro as an  accompanying instrument of the popular song, not lyrical. We place this  autonomous music learning resource within the framework of a long tradition of informal education in Venezuela. Limiting the publications between the mid-50s of the 20th century, until the second decade of the 21st century, with the appearance of online sites and platforms that have expanded content and resources, maintaining some characteristics that have demonstrated their pedagogical success through time. The level of social relevance of cuatro is commented, as well as some initiatives in non-formal education that give continuity to its study and to that of traditional music in Venezuela.
